Программные продукты для трехмерной реконструкции - Программа трехмерной реконструкции сцены по изображениям и данным сканирования глубины

Программные продукты, разработанные для трехмерного сканирования c использованием RGB-D камер, имеют много сходств в организации процесса сканирования и построении пользовательского интерфейса, поскольку основаны на алгоритме KinectFusion. В качестве примера таких продуктов будут рассмотрены Scanect [11] и RecFusion [10].

Процесс сканирования проходит следующим образом: после первоначальной настройки параметров (объем сканируемого пространства, детализация) производится процесс сканирования: камера плавно перемещается пользователем, охватывая поверхность сканируемого объекта. Полигональная модель строится в режиме реального времени, используя поступающие с камеры снимки глубины для обновления. В программе визуализируется текущая карта глубины и реконструируемая модель. Отслеживается смещения камеры относительно предыдущего положения. После геометрической реконструкции производится вычисление цвета вершин модели. Пользователю предлагается экспорт полученной модели в файл. Дополнительно есть функции для заполнения дыр в полигональной модели, обрезки, сглаживания и подготовки к 3D печати.

Программные продукты являются платными (стоимость лицензии на одного пользователя Scanect или RecFusion - 99€), но обладают широкой функциональностью и удобным пользовательским интерфейсом. Программы также позволяют выполнять вычисления как на GPU, так и на CPU.

Похожие статьи




Программные продукты для трехмерной реконструкции - Программа трехмерной реконструкции сцены по изображениям и данным сканирования глубины

Предыдущая | Следующая